Qatar Masters
Click here to receive alerts when this page is updated

 

R1 18 Hole Match Bet.   Sell A.Wall v P. Broadhurst 0.25pts @ 0  (Sporting Index)

Wall missed cut on his latest start which was in November last year, so may also be a little rusty too. Broadhurst shook off his break in last weeks event so may arguably be the more prepared today. R1 h2h stats over the last year show Wall winning 8 out of the 19 joint events, and on this course historically just 1 win in 5 attempts. The value lies in opposing Wall. (mu -16) Profit +4pts

72 Hole Sporting Hotshots.  Sell Hotshots 0.25pts @ 32 (sporting index)

Sporting's hotshots this week consist of Westwood, Karlsson, Jaidee and Mcginlay. All capable on their day, but with this market our primary concern is seeking out players that won't win this week, and to my eyes I can't see any of the quarter doing so. A top ten finish from one of them is certainly possible but we have a strong field this week and for one of them to finish in the top ten would still leave us in profit.  The market works at 25pts per top ten finish with a 25pt bonus if one of the four goes on to win the tournament, so there is a large-ish downside to be aware of. (mu 25) Profit +1.75pts
